Big Tree Ridge Trail & Newport Way Trail is a 2.9-mile out-and-back in Cougar Mountain Regional Wildland Park near Pine Lake, WA. It climbs 375 ft, with sections as steep as 23% grade. It scores 0/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: paved and peopled.

- Start on 15th Place Northwest, heading S.
- 150 ftBear right, heading SW.
- 0.6 miTurn right onto Newport Way Trail, heading S.
- 0.5 miTurn left, heading NW.
- 0.4 miReach Newport Way Trail, then turn around and head back the way you came.
- 0.9 miTurn left, heading SE.
- 0.6 miBear left onto 15th Place Northwest, heading NE.
- 50 ftArrive back at the trailhead.
Each distance is the walk from the previous step. Tap a step for a map of its junction.
